    IIM Calcutta scholarship comes under the financial aid scheme for financially weaker students. The IIM Calcutta scholarships are granted to candidates upon satisfactory eligibility check. IIM Calcutta scholarship tends to be rewarded based on merit, need, diversity, academic performance, etc. Candidates can apply to various IIM Calcutta Scholarship 2025 as per the one which they seem to be fit for. To provide equal opportunity to all students, IIM Calcutta offers financial assistance for its various management programs in the form of IIM Calcutta Scholarships and educational loans from different, tied-up financial institutions at reasonable interest rates.

    IIM Calcutta scholarships can be of various types depending on the way they are catered to the candidates. The various types of IIM Calcutta scholarship 2025 are mentioned below.

    1. Merit-based IIM Calcutta scholarship: Given to candidates with extraordinary academic performance at school and graduation level along with exceptional performance in MBA entrance exams.

    1. Need-Based IIM Calcutta scholarship: Given to candidates coming from poor backgrounds.

    1. Diversity and Gender-based IIM Calcutta scholarship: Given to candidates coming from diverse religious and cultural backgrounds.

    1. External IIM Calcutta scholarship: Given to students by companies that employ MBA graduates to bring new talent into their workspace.

    Eligibility Criteria IIM Calcutta Scholarship

    The eligibility criteria for an IIM Calcutta scholarship is specific to the particular scholarship. The eligibility criteria vary for every individual IIM Calcutta scholarship 2025. However, a few of the conditions remain the same. Having these increases the probability of a candidate being considered for the IIM Calcutta scholarship. The general eligibility criteria for the IIM Calcutta scholarship 2025 is as follows.

    • A Bachelor’s degree from a recognized university or equivalent institution.

    • Excellent academic records at school and college level.

    • Letter of recommendation from institutions.

    • A justifiable reason to be granted a scholarship.

    • Exceptional performance in various MBA entrance exams such as CAT.

    Documents Required for IIM Calcutta Scholarship

    For an employed (salaried) person, the following documents are required:

    • If the annual income of the person is less than Rs. 2.50 Lakhs, a certified copy of Income Tax returns (ITR-1, ITR-2, etc.) OR salary certificate from the employer. Applicants are strongly advised to submit the ITR documents alone. Other documents may take more time to verify and attract greater scrutiny.

    • If the annual income of the person is Rs. 2.50 Lakhs or more, Form-16.

    If the person is self-employed in business, agriculture, or any other profession, the following documents are required:

    • If the annual income of the person is less than Rs. 2.50 Lakhs, a certified copy of Income Tax returns (ITR-1, ITR-2, etc.). Applicants are strongly advised to submit the ITR documents alone. Other documents may take more time to verify and attract greater scrutiny.

    • If the annual income of the person is Rs. 2.50 Lakhs or more, a certified copy of Income Tax returns (ITR-1, ITR-2, etc.).

    If the person is retired, the following documents are required:

    • If the annual income of the person is less than Rs. 2.50 Lakhs, a certified copy of Income Tax returns (ITR-1, ITR-2, etc.) Other documents may take more time to verify and attract greater scrutiny.

    • If the annual income of the person is Rs. 2.50 Lakhs or more, a pension certificate from the employer and certified copy of Income Tax returns (ITR-1, ITR-2, etc.).

    Q: What is the salary after MBA in IIM Calcutta?
    A:

    The highest MBA salary package offered at IIM Calcutta was around Rs. 1.2 CPA (Crores per annum). The average salary package offered to MBA students at IIM Calcutta is Rs. 35.07 lakhs per annum.

    Q: Is there any Scholarship in IIM Calcutta?
    A:

    The IIM Calcutta offers many scholarships that are granted to candidates upon satisfactory eligibility check. IIM Calcutta scholarship tends to be rewarded based on merit, need, diversity, academic performance, etc.

    Q: What is the MBA fee for IIM Calcutta?
    A:

    The MBA fee for IIM Calcutta is approximately Rs. 31 lakhs for two years.

    Q: What is the highest stipend in IIM Calcutta?
    A:

    The highest stipend for the summer internship at IIM Calcutta was around Rs. 3.75 lakhs per month. The median stipend for the summer internship was close to Rs. 1.7 lakhs per month.
